Position Overview: The Administrative Assistant III supports and coordinates a variety of services and programs on behalf of the Florida Charter Institute (FCI). The position works closely with the Executive Team to support programs and services being conducted by the Institute. The position will also navigate and coordinate between the Institute and the larger Miami Dade College administrative structure. This is a Professional Exempt Contractual (PEC) position for which an annual contract reflecting the base salary within the fiscal year (July 1st to June 30th) will be issued after ratification by Miami Dade College’s District Board of Trustee. This is a temporary grant funded position. This grant position will be eligible for participation in the Florida Retirement System (FRS) after 6 consecutive months of continuous employment.

What you will be doing: Works closely with the Florida Charter Institute (FCI) leadership team to ensure follow up and administrative support to services and activities being conducted by the FCI. Serves as a liaison for the FCI and the Miami Dade College administrative structure. Builds relationships with key contacts within the Miami Dade College administrative structure to be able to navigate the needs of the FCI to ensure projects are completed successfully. Generates POs and financial reports within the MDC system as needed by the Institute. Provides administrative support with regard to the various projects undertaken by the Institute. Attends Team Meetings and other cross-function meetings as applicable. Manages assigned logistics pertaining to in person events, including copies and supplies, tech needs and troubleshooting, catering/food deliveries, and (where applicable) liaising with the MDC events team. Works with the Department of Education’s certification system to ensure in-service points are award to FCI training participants, and answers questions from participants should they arise. Monitors and ensures timely attention to tasks as assigned within the team’s project management system. Organizes and maintains the Florida Charter Institute office, including furniture, supply, and tech needs. Maintains relevant documentations for the operation for the Florida Charter Institute. Monitors and ensures timely completion of requests made to FCI through the helpdesk ticket system. Coordinates travel arrangements and expense reimbursements as needed. Performs other duties as assigned.

Since we opened our doors in 1960, the educators at Miami Dade College have focused on providing quality and innovative educational opportunities to every member of our community desiring a higher education. Our goal is a simple one, to ensure the success of our students and increase the strength of our communities.

Today, Miami Dade College is the largest, most diverse and highly regarded college in the nation. We operate eight campuses with over 6,000 employees who educate over 170,000 students from around the world. The College offers over 300 programs of study and several degree options, including vocational, associate, and baccalaureate degrees. We also offer numerous Community Education classes as well as online credit classes through the Virtual College. Specialized and advanced educational opportunities include the prestigious New World School of the Arts, The Honors College and our Dual Enrollment Program.
